#6ce508 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6ce508 is composed of 42.4% red, 89.8%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.5%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 92.9 degrees, a saturation of 93.2% and a lightness of 46.5%. #6ce508 color hex could be obtained by blending #d8ff10 with #00cb00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#6ce508 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6ce508 has RGB values of R:108, G:229,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0, Y:0.97,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 7136520.

Shades and Tints of #6ce508
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010200 is the darkest color, while #f5feee is the lightest one.

Tones of #6ce508
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767875 is the less saturated color, while #6ce508 is the most saturated one.
